How to connect Jibble and Tavily
Create a New Scenario to Connect Jibble and Tavily
In the workspace, click the “Create New Scenario” button.

Add the First Step
Add the first node – a trigger that will initiate the scenario when it receives the required event. Triggers can be scheduled, called by a Jibble, triggered by another scenario, or executed manually (for testing purposes). In most cases, Jibble or Tavily will be your first step. To do this, click "Choose an app," find Jibble or Tavily, and select the appropriate trigger to start the scenario.

Authenticate Tavily
Now, click the Tavily node and select the connection option. This can be an OAuth2 connection or an API key, which you can obtain in your Tavily settings. Authentication allows you to use Tavily through Latenode.
Configure the Jibble and Tavily Nodes
Next, configure the nodes by filling in the required parameters according to your logic. Fields marked with a red asterisk (*) are mandatory.
Set Up the Jibble and Tavily Integration
Use various Latenode nodes to transform data and enhance your integration:
- Branching: Create multiple branches within the scenario to handle complex logic.
- Merging: Combine different node branches into one, passing data through it.
- Plug n Play Nodes: Use nodes that don’t require account credentials.
- Ask AI: Use the GPT-powered option to add AI capabilities to any node.
- Wait: Set waiting times, either for intervals or until specific dates.
- Sub-scenarios (Nodules): Create sub-scenarios that are encapsulated in a single node.
- Iteration: Process arrays of data when needed.
- Code: Write custom code or ask our AI assistant to do it for you.

Save and Activate the Scenario
After configuring Jibble, Tavily, and any additional nodes, don’t forget to save the scenario and click "Deploy." Activating the scenario ensures it will run automatically whenever the trigger node receives input or a condition is met. By default, all newly created scenarios are deactivated.
Test the Scenario
Run the scenario by clicking “Run once” and triggering an event to check if the Jibble and Tavily integration works as expected. Depending on your setup, data should flow between Jibble and Tavily (or vice versa). Easily troubleshoot the scenario by reviewing the execution history to identify and fix any issues.
Most powerful ways to connect Jibble and Tavily
Jibble + Tavily + Slack: When a new clock-in or clock-out event occurs in Jibble, the employee's name is used to search Tavily for relevant work-related information. The search results are then posted to a dedicated Slack channel for team awareness and transparency.
Jibble + Tavily + Google Sheets: When a new clock-in or clock-out event happens in Jibble, Tavily performs a web search using a predefined query. The Jibble time entry data and the Tavily search results are then recorded in a Google Sheets spreadsheet for detailed activity analysis and reporting.
